1、将字符的数字转成数字,比如’0’转成0可以直接用加法来实现

例如:将user表中的uid 进行排序,可uid的定义为varchar,可以这样解决

select * from user order by (uid+0)

2、在进行ifnull处理时,比如 ifnull(a/b,’0′) 这样就会导致 a/b成了字符串,因此需要把’0’改成0,即可解决此困扰

3、比较数字和varchar时,比如a=11,b=”11ddddd”;

则 select 11=”11ddddd”相等

若绝对比较可以这样:

select binary 11 =binary “11ddddd”

另外:

今天看到Mysql的 Cast和Convert函数,也能实现‘字符数字转换为数字’

两者具体的语法如下:

Cast(value as type); Convert(value ,type);

type不是都可以滴,可以转换的type如下:

二进制,同带binary前缀的效果 : BINARY

字符型,可带参数 : CHAR()

日期 : DATE

时间: TIME

日期时间型 : DATETIME

浮点数 : DECIMAL

整数 : SIGNED

无符号整数 : UNSIGNED

mysql中字符转数字,MYSQL字符数字转换为数字相关推荐

  1. mysql 修改结束符_在MySQL中,用于设置MySQL结束符的关键字是【】

    在MySQL中,用于设置MySQL结束符的关键字是[] 答:DELIMITER 截至目前,还没有科学家从事克隆人的实验研究.() 答:× 智慧职教: 在选择压力表的量程时,一般不超过满量程的( ). ...

  2. mysql中的函数有哪些?(1.数字函数)

    一.函数类型 1.数学函数和控制流函数 2.字符串函数 3.日期和时间函数 4.系统信息函数和加密函数 二.解析数学函数及其包含的类型 1.数学函数是用来处理数值数据方面的运算,MySQL 中主要的数 ...

  3. mysql中输入中文或英文 字符类型的设置

    以字段name为例 mysql中默认的是输入英文名,用的phpstudy,此时数据库(点击右键)--属性--字符集(latin1) 若要输入中文名'张三',此时将数据库中点击数据库(点击右键)--属性 ...

  4. c#语言中怎么样把文本转换成数字,如何将字符串转换为数字 - C# 编程指南 | Microsoft Docs...

    如何将字符串转换为数字(C# 编程指南) 02/16/2021 本文内容 你可以调用数值类型(int.long.double 等)中找到的 Parse 或 TryParse 方法或使用 System. ...

  5. mysql中select使用方法,MySQL中select语句介绍及使用示例

    数据表都已经创建起来了,假设我们已经插入了许多的数据,我们就可以用自己喜欢的方式对数据表里面的信息进行检索和显示了,比如说:可以象下面这样把整个数据表内的内容都显示出来 select * from p ...

  6. mysql 中日韩 乱码,mysql字符集乱码问题解决方法介绍

    character-set-server/default-character-set:服务器字符集,默认情况下所采用的. character-set-database:数据库字符集. characte ...

  7. mysql中int最大多少,MySQL中int最大值深入讲解

    MySQL中int最大值深入讲解 导语 前两天看到的问题,展开写一下. 字节 我们都知道计算机是以二进制为基础.存储的基本单位是 Bit,也称为比特.二进制位.1bit 可以表示 0 或者 1 两个数 ...

  8. mysql中trim什么意思,mysql中trim的作用是什么

    mysql中trim函数的作用是可以过滤指定的字符串,格式为[TRIM([{BOTH | LEADING | TRAILING} [remstr] FROM] str)]. trim函数可以过滤指定的 ...

  9. mysql中的钱null,mysql 中null总结

    ====================== 相信很多用了mysql很久的人,对这两个字段属性的概念还不是很清楚,一般会有以下疑问: 1.我字段类型是not null,为什么我可以插入空值 2.为毛n ...

  10. mysql中约束_【MySQL】:MySQL中四大约束

    所有的关系型数据库都支持对数据表使用约束,在表上强制执行数据校验,保证数据的完整性. MySQL数据库支持以下四种约束形式: 非空约束 NOT NULL 所有数值类型的值都可以为null. 空字符串和 ...

最新文章

  1. Nature综述:植物与微生物组的相互作用:从群落装配到植物健康(上)
  2. 无意中发现了一位清华大佬的代码模版
  3. 软件回归测试及其实践
  4. 哈尔滨工程大学ACM预热赛
  5. 使用vim打开文件的16进制形式,编辑和全文替换
  6. 关情纸尾-----Quartz2D-绘制富文本,绘制图片.
  7. 虚拟机中CentOS 7 网络服务启动失败
  8. GEF入门实例_总结_04_Eclipse插件启动流程分析
  9. Linux下安装PHP扩展 pdo_sqlsrv
  10. 开发竞赛作品展示网站上线!
  11. 刚开始接触编程也能轻松写的计算器代码(VS2019)(c语言)
  12. FFT中频谱泄露的两种理解
  13. PHP之字符串常用函数
  14. Ubuntu16.04cuda8与cuda10共存,同时使用Tensorflow1.13.1(需重装显卡驱动)
  15. LeetCode 5855. 找出数组中的第 K 大整数(自定义排序函数)
  16. 抽象类和接口的小程序
  17. 崩坏3服务器修改水晶数量,崩坏3半年不氪金能攒多少水晶 半积年攒水晶数量详情...
  18. Regionals 2015 Asia - Daejeon acmliveoj7233 - Polynomial
  19. 《论工业社会及其未来》—泰德.卡辛斯基
  20. [概率论]图像里的“白噪声”——电视机搜不到台时雪花斑点的形成原因 (不信谣,不传谣,与宇宙微波背景辐射没有任何关系)

热门文章

  1. C语言中在写输入代码时,在几个%d之间不加空格分开,与用逗号分开,以及采用a=%d,这样写的输入代码有什么区别呢?
  2. 处理2倍图片和3倍图片
  3. 【AI测试】也许这有你想知道的人工智能 (AI) 测试--第二篇
  4. 16级C++第三次上机解题报告
  5. 【CC评网】2013.第41周 不求排版,简单就好
  6. CSNET上网图文使用教程
  7. 简书iOS客户端更新日志150912-评论分享/手机号及微信登录/本地草稿保存等
  8. 广州.NET微软技术俱乐部休闲活动 - 每周三五晚周日下午爬白云山活动
  9. 中文输入法 linux 下载64位,最新搜狗输入法linux版v2.2.0.0108 官方版(32位+64位)下载地址电脑版-锐品软件...
  10. 工作占用了太多私人时间_职场谋略:下班后领导总发微信占用私人时间,怎么应对?...